titleOfInvention | Manufacture for solidified material of silk |
abstract | PURPOSE: To enable holding of fixed mechanical strength and a specific property which is possessed by silk, by a method wherein powder of the silk is heated and compressed within a die at a temperature of not exceedding 200°C and pressure of at least 100 kg/cm 2 . n CONSTITUTION: It is preferable that a mean particle diameter of powder of silk is 0.3-100 μm. The powder of the silk like this is obtained by a method wherein a cocoon or the silk is made into a silk solution by putting them into a solution of calcium chloride, which is treated under boiling water, concentrated through a dialysis film, frozen and restored to the normal temperature again, the water and silk are made into a separate state from each other and the silk is made into the powder by freezing and drying the silk. A binder or the other substance may be incorporated into the silk powder. In the case where the water is used as the binder, the rate of the water to the whole is made into 2-25 wt.%, preferably 8-12 wt.%. The foregoing powder of the silk is heated and compressed within a die. It is preferable that a heating temperature is 200°C or less and pressing pressure is at least 100 kg/cm 2 . n COPYRIGHT: (C)1991,JPO&Japio |
